After flying high against the Alcovy Tigers on Thursday, the Woodward Academy War Eagles came back down to earth. Woodward Academy's rough 81-60 loss to Galloway on Saturday might stick with them for a while. Having run the score up that high, both teams probably have some extra defensive drills coming up.
Despite the loss, Woodward Academy had strong showings from Kameron Herring, who scored 21 points along with 8 rebounds and 3 steals, and Delaney Cooper, who scored 11 points along with 5 steals. The contest was Herring's fourth in a row with at least ten points. Kami Whitner was another key contributor, scoring 5 points.
Woodward Academy's loss dropped their record down to 3-2. As for Galloway, the victory was the third in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 4-2.
Woodward Academy will head out on the road to face off against Mundy's Mill at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Galloway,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Cedar Grove at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
